Responsibilities:
Conduct comprehensive assessments to identify clients' needs and develop personalized care plans
Assist clients in accessing and utilizing community resources, including mental health services, housing programs, and government benefits
Advocate for clients' rights and needs within various systems, including healthcare, social services and legal services
Provide crisis intervention and support as needed
Collaborate with other healthcare professionals, social workers, and service providers to coordinate comprehensive care
Monitor clients' progress and adjust care plans as necessary to ensure optimal outcomes
Maintain accurate and up-to-date client records and documentation
Educate clients and their families about mental health issues, available resources, and coping strategies
Participate in team meetings, training sessions, and professional development opportunities
